    What is Hyperpocket?
    Hyperpocket is a modular inference engine that allows developers to import pre-trained large language models, convert them into optimized formats, and run them locally with minimal dependencies. It supports quantization techniques to reduce model size and accelerate performance on CPUs and ARM-based devices. The framework exposes both C++ and Python interfaces, enabling seamless integration into existing applications and pipelines. Hyperpocket automatically manages memory allocation, tokenization, and batching to deliver consistent low-latency responses. Its cross-platform design means the same model can run on Windows, Linux, macOS, and embedded systems without modification. This makes Hyperpocket ideal for implementing privacy-focused chatbots, offline data analysis, and custom AI-powered tools on edge hardware.

    What is Salad - GPU Cloud?
    Salad is a software that converts idle time on your computer into rewards and offers a distributed cloud platform for computing needs. Users can run the Salad app to utilize their computer's idle processing power to earn rewards, such as gift cards, game subscriptions, and hardware. Additionally, Salad offers cloud computing services for AI/ML production models, providing significant cost advantages for users.

    What is mindspore.cn?
    MindSpore is designed to simplify the development and deployment of AI models across various platforms. Its key features include easy-to-use APIs, efficient execution, and support for a wide range of hardware. MindSpore facilitates collaborative development and efficient resource utilization, making it ideal for research, industrial applications, and educational purposes. Additionally, it offers robust security and privacy measures, ensuring the safe use of AI technologies.
